billmac
Member
Hi
Just some info from all you that live in Houston (USA) I am coming over next month for a few days and would like to know the best hobby shops for quad stuff. I have visited most of the hobby shops in the past however I was not into quads.
Any help on this much appreciated.
Thanks
billmac
Just some info from all you that live in Houston (USA) I am coming over next month for a few days and would like to know the best hobby shops for quad stuff. I have visited most of the hobby shops in the past however I was not into quads.
Any help on this much appreciated.
Thanks
billmac